What education do you need to become an assistant professor of surgery?

What degree do you need to be an assistant professor of surgery?

The most common degree for assistant professors of surgery is doctoral degree, with 42% of assistant professors of surgery ear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are bachelor's degree degree at 25% and bachelor's degree degree at 13%.
  • Doctorate, 42%
  • Bachelor's, 25%
  • Master's, 13%
  • Associate, 3%
  • Other Degrees, 17%

What should I major in to become an assistant professor of surgery?

You should major in medicine to become an assistant professor of surgery. 31% of assistant professors of surgery major in medicine. Other common majors for an assistant professor of surgery include biology and biochemistry, biophysics, molecular biology.

Average assistant professor of surgery salary by education level

According to our data, assistant professors of surgery with a Doctorate degree earn the highest average salary, at $397,648 annually. Assistant professors of surgery with a Master's degree earn an average annual salary of $290,617.
Assistant professor of surgery education levelAssistant professor of surgery salary
Master's Degree$290,617
Doctorate Degree$397,648
